JOB OVERVIEW: LEARNING TECHNOLOGIES SUPPORT ANALYST The Learning Technologies Support Analyst provides system and application administration and instructional and technical support for the development, maintenance, and enhancement of KPUs learning technology systems and technologies. The Analyst investigates and troubleshoots problems with institutionally supported systems and technologies; responds to technology service requests; provides assistance to users that have instructional and content creation questions related to the University's Learning Management System and other technologies; provides information resources, support and training to KPU faculty and instructors and other educators on the institutionally supported learning management system and learning technologies. As a member of the learning technology team, this position is also responsible for researching, maintaining currency and reporting on designated existing and emerging learning technologies and systems and for producing user documentation.
